[Python-checkins] CVS: python/dist/src/Lib pdb.py,1.50,1.51

Tim Peters tim_one@users.sourceforge.net
Fri, 09 Feb 2001 15:28:09 -0800


Update of /cvsroot/python/python/dist/src/Lib
In directory usw-pr-cvs1:/tmp/cvs-serv20043/python/dist/src/Lib

Modified Files:
	pdb.py 
Log Message:
SF bug #131560:  pdb imports 'repr', causing name collision


Index: pdb.py
===================================================================
RCS file: /cvsroot/python/python/dist/src/Lib/pdb.py,v
retrieving revision 1.50
retrieving revision 1.51
diff -C2 -r1.50 -r1.51
*** pdb.py	2001/02/09 07:58:53	1.50
--- pdb.py	2001/02/09 23:28:07	1.51
***************
*** 9,13 ****
  import cmd
  import bdb
! import repr
  import os
  import re
--- 9,13 ----
  import cmd
  import bdb
! from repr import repr as _saferepr
  import os
  import re
***************
*** 125,129 ****
              exc_type_name = exc_type
          else: exc_type_name = exc_type.__name__
!         print exc_type_name + ':', repr.repr(exc_value)
          self.interaction(frame, exc_traceback)
  
--- 125,129 ----
              exc_type_name = exc_type
          else: exc_type_name = exc_type.__name__
!         print exc_type_name + ':', _saferepr(exc_value)
          self.interaction(frame, exc_traceback)